AI Summary

HJR263 Summary

  • Recognizes the establishment of the Fredric Rosemore Patriotism Award by the 4-H programs of Franklin, Colbert, Lauderdale, and Lawrence Counties in honor of Dr. Fredric Rosemore.

  • Honors Dr. Rosemore's military service, including completion of 22 combat missions as a B-17 navigator in World War II, his capture and imprisonment in a Nazi prison camp, and his receipt of the Air Medal Oak Leaf Cluster, Presidential Unit Citation, five Battle Stars, Prisoner of War Medal, and two Purple Hearts.

  • Recognizes Dr. Rosemore's career as an optometrist, his philanthropic work including donations of eyeglasses to disadvantaged children and free eye care to indigent and elderly persons, and his creation of PMC Capital worth over $500 million.

  • Establishes that the award will be bestowed on candidates who share Dr. Rosemore's love for the United States and live by the 4-H Pledge emphasizing clear thinking, loyalty, service, and healthy living.

  • Directs the legislature to provide copies of the resolution to the 4-H programs of Franklin, Colbert, Lauderdale, and Lawrence Counties and to Dr. Rosemore's family as recognition of his contributions to Alabama and the nation.
